Comparison highlights

  • Moat score gap: Colgate-Palmolive Company leads (74 / 100 vs 59 / 100 for Analog Devices, Inc.).
  • Segment focus: Analog Devices, Inc. has 4 segments (44.7% in Industrial); Colgate-Palmolive Company has 4 segments (43% in Oral Care).
  • Primary market structure: Oligopoly vs Oligopoly. Pricing power: Strong vs Moderate.
  • Moat breadth: Analog Devices, Inc. has 5 moat types across 2 domains; Colgate-Palmolive Company has 2 across 2.
